Some seasons of life feel steady. Others feel like standing at a crossroads in fog.

You make a choice, but you cannot see far ahead. You wait for a call, a result, a diagnosis, a reply, an open door. In those moments, life can feel like a roll of the dice.

That phrase sounds random, yet it names a real human feeling. We do not control every outcome. We can prepare, pray, work, and hope. Still, some parts of life remain hidden until they unfold.

This is where blessings matter.

A blessing does not erase uncertainty. It gives the heart something solid to hold while uncertainty remains. It offers peace without pretending that every answer is already visible.

This article reflects on blessings for such moments. It explores how faith, hope, and simple words of comfort help people walk through seasons they cannot fully predict.

Why Uncertain Moments Feel So Heavy

Uncertainty weighs on the mind.

When outcomes remain unknown, the brain keeps searching for answers. It runs scenarios again and again. One possibility leads to another. Sleep becomes lighter. Thoughts grow louder.

This reaction is natural. Humans prefer clear paths. When the road disappears into fog, tension rises.

Think about waiting for an exam result. Or waiting for news after a job interview. The work is done, yet the outcome remains hidden. The mind cannot move forward, yet it cannot rest either.

Blessings That Bring Calm During Uncertain Seasons

When life feels unstable, people reach for words that steady the heart. A blessing serves that role.

A blessing does not predict the result. It creates space for peace while the result remains unknown. The words act like a quiet hand on the shoulder.

Short blessings often work best. They carry warmth without adding noise.

For example:

“May peace guard your mind today.”

“May courage walk beside you.”

“May the path ahead open at the right time.”

Each line offers support without forcing certainty. The blessing recognizes effort and invites calm.

These words matter because uncertainty often amplifies fear. The mind imagines every possible outcome, especially the worst ones. A blessing interrupts that spiral. It shifts attention from imagined outcomes to present strength.

The effect resembles stepping out of a storm into a quiet room. The world outside still moves, yet the heart regains balance.

People across cultures use blessings in moments like these. Parents speak them over children before exams. Friends send them before important meetings. Families share them before journeys.

The words may be simple, but their meaning is clear: you do not walk this moment alone.

How Faith Reframes Moments Of Chance

Uncertain moments often feel random. Events appear outside our control. Plans change without warning. Doors close or open in ways we did not expect.

Faith offers a different lens.

Instead of viewing life as pure chance, faith suggests that uncertainty may still carry purpose and direction, even when we cannot see it yet.

Think of a traveler walking through fog. The traveler cannot see the entire road. Yet each step still moves forward. Faith works the same way. It allows a person to keep walking without needing the full map.

This perspective changes how people interpret moments that feel like a gamble.

Rather than asking, Why is everything uncertain?, faith encourages a quieter question: What can I trust while the outcome unfolds?

Blessings often reflect this shift.

“May wisdom guide your steps.”

“May courage rise when the road feels unclear.”

“May the right door open at the right time.”

These words acknowledge uncertainty without surrendering hope. They recognize that life contains mystery, yet they affirm that the journey still holds meaning.

Faith does not remove unpredictability. It replaces panic with steady confidence.
